When considering the advantages of foreign direct investment, it is necessary to likewise consider the home country that is offering the financial investment. There is really a whole plethora of FDI benefits for get more info the home country to experience. For a start, investing in an overseas country gives companies the chance to access brand-new customer markets. Among the fundamental pillars of business development is international expansion, and FDI is a superb way to improve a business's scope and attract a greater volume of clients, consumers and investors. For companies, FDI can be among the most efficient ways to take their business to a whole other level, reach unmatched levels of prosperity and boost their total profitability. In addition, another one of the main incentives of an FDI for home nations is the chance to locate reduced production expenses and accessibility to important resources which may not be offered domestically. Foreign direct investment (FDI) occurs when a business or individual from one nation invests into a different country overseas. FDI can can be found in various different forms, ranging from developing brand-new global business, acquiring international stocks, bonds and assets, or forming foreign business partnerships. Unlike short-term capital flows, among the primary reasons for foreign direct investment is lasting gains and economic development, as demonstrated by the different Malta foreign investment initiatives. The core function of an FDI is to supply favorable results for both countries. The FDI benefits for the host country, or otherwise referred to as the country getting the financial investment, are significant and wide-reaching. Arguably, the most notable benefit is the work production that comes with many FDI projects. When international companies launch brand-new operations abroad, they tend to work with regional workers that have the required understanding and skills to design, develop and maintain operations. Not only does this increase employment in the host nation's community, however it can likewise bring about new interesting opportunities, better infrastructure and higher incomes.
